Where This Mockup Shines and Where It Needs Care

The Comfort Colors 1717 Mockup 17 works best on medium-weight fabrics like cotton or polyester blends. It’s particularly well-suited for tote bag design, embroidered patch, and holiday embroidery projects. However, if you’re planning to use it on thin fabric, stretchy fabric, or curved surfaces like caps, you’ll need to adjust stitch density and test it first on scrap fabric.

This mockup isn’t ideal for small hoop sizes due to its level of detail. If you’re working on tiny lettering or dense stitch areas, you may need to simplify the design or break it into sections. Also, for layered garments or products that will be washed frequently, using the right stabilizer is crucial to prevent shifting or distortion.
